KATHLEEN PETERSON Obituary

Kathleen Anne Weidkamp Peterson Kathleen was born on May 28, 1928 in Lynden, WA to T. Milton and Nell Ecker Weidkamp. She passed away on January 22, 2011 in Tacoma, WA where she had lived since 1954 with her devoted husband of over 60 years; married December 16, 1950 in Lynden. She received her education degree from the University of Puget Sound in 1967 and taught Home Economics at Mt. Tahoma High School in Tacoma for 15 years, retiring in 1983. Active in the community, she belonged to and held offices in numerous organizations including P.E.O., Tacoma Home Economists Association, Ladies Musical Club, Retired Teachers Association, UPS Women's League and UPS Faculty Women's Club. A lifelong member of the Methodist Church, she served in many ways: in leadership of the United Methodist Women; soloing and singing in choir; and making prayer shawls and food for church outreach programs. She and Frank team-taught AARP Driver Safety Classes for 4 years. Kathleen had great interest in and compassion for others. She loved the ocean, music, roses, reading, handwork, and her beloved family, which includes her husband Frank, daughters Leann (Richard) O'Neill and Carol (Peter) Pitman, grandchildren Elizabeth Kathleen O'Neill, Peter John Pitman, Jr. and Brian Scott Pitman, all of Gig Harbor, WA; twin brother, Ken Weidkamp of Beaverton, OR, and special extended family of in-laws, nieces, nephews and cousins.
